    Chelsea’s pursuit of Michael Olise remains one of the most talked-about transfer sagas involving Crystal Palace in recent years, with fresh details continuing to emerge regarding the controversial move.

     

    Reports at the time suggested Chelsea had activated the release clause contained within Olise’s Crystal Palace contract and were confident of completing a deal for the highly-rated winger. The move appeared straightforward, with the London club believing they had followed the correct process to secure one of the Premier League’s most exciting young talents.

     

    Had the transfer been completed, Crystal Palace would have received Β£35 million for the 21-year-old attacker, who was recovering from injury at the time but remained a highly sought-after player due to his outstanding performances in the Premier League.

     

    Olise had enjoyed a breakthrough period at Selhurst Park, establishing himself as one of the division’s most creative attacking players. His ability to beat defenders, create chances and influence matches from wide areas attracted attention from several elite clubs, with Chelsea among the most determined admirers.

     

    What made the situation particularly controversial was the sequence of events that followed Chelsea’s decision to trigger the release clause. According to reports, personal terms had already been discussed and an agreement on wages was believed to have been reached between Chelsea and the player’s representatives.

     

    However, rather than allowing the transfer to proceed, Crystal Palace moved quickly to convince Olise to remain at the club. The Eagles offered the winger an improved long-term contract, significantly enhancing his existing terms and providing further incentives to continue his development in South London.

     

    The move ultimately proved successful. Olise rejected the proposed switch to Stamford Bridge and instead committed his future to Crystal Palace by signing a new contract.

     

    The aftermath created considerable debate among supporters and pundits alike. Some Chelsea fans felt frustrated by the outcome, arguing that the club had activated a legitimate release clause and had every reason to believe the deal would be completed.

    From Palace’s perspective, however, retaining one of their most valuable assets represented a major victory. The club demonstrated its growing ambition by resisting interest from one of the Premier League’s biggest spenders and securing the long-term future of a player regarded as central to their plans.

     

    While Chelsea eventually turned their attention elsewhere, the Olise saga remains one of the most memorable transfer battles involving Crystal Palace in recent seasons, highlighting the club’s determination to hold on to its brightest talents despite interest from Europe’s elite.
